Job Description

Salary: $75,600 annually

Location: Westchester & Bronx

Schedule: Monday-Friday 9am-5pm

The Behavior Intervention Specialist (BIS) is responsible for assisting in the development and implementation of Behavior Support Plans (BSPs) and training Direct Support Professionals (DSPs) in effective, proactive behavioral techniques. This role includes leading trainings, group activities, and modeling positive behavioral interventions across SCFU locations in the Bronx and Westchester County. You will be working with adults with autism in a residential/program setting. 

Position Responsibilities:

  • Implement and supervise Behavioral Support Plans (BSPs) and Monitoring Plans as needed.
  • Ensure effective communication regarding behavioral occurrences with support staff and advocates.
  • Lead 1:1 and group sessions, including educational workshops on self-advocacy, sexuality, and other topics.
  • Accurately collect and analyze behavioral data, updating plans monthly to ensure goal progress.
  • Provide direct instruction to support goal attainment and facilitate informed consents for participants.
  • Observe and support DSPs with plan implementation, offering feedback and maintaining an environment conducive to positive learning.
  • Participate in Interdisciplinary Team (IDT) meetings, ensuring compliance with OPWDD regulations and clinical documentation.
  • Track document/report due dates and maintain paperwork in accordance with NYS (OPWDD) standards.
  • Obtain SCIP-R instructor certification to train staff in behavioral intervention techniques.

Training and Support Responsibilities:

  • Conduct Functional Behavior Analyses (FBA) and record relevant behavioral observations.
  • Lead trainings on ABA principles and other skills needed for supporting individuals with autism.
  • Collaborate with program supervisors, assist with staff disciplinary actions as needed, and ensure clear communication on behavioral issues.
  • Serve as an advocate for program improvement, providing a respectful and supportive environment for individuals and their families.

Skills & Abilities

  • Master's degree with specials consideration given to those possessing or in coursework for BCBA)
  • 1-2 years’ experience and training in applied behavior analysis (ABA) strategies and implementing behavioral supports for people with autism.
  • Valid NY Driver’s license is required
